Instructional payroll mix vs Ohio median

Among 653 Ohio districts that break out F-33 program salary totals, Huber Heights City's instructional payroll puts 26.0% into special education , 6.6 points above the state median of 19.5%. That heavier special-education share usually means more of the teacher-salary pool is tied to IEP-driven staffing than at a typical Ohio peer.

Program Huber Heights OH median Gap
Regular program 74.0% 78.0% -4.0 pp
Special education 26.0% 19.5% +6.6 pp
Vocational programs 0.0% 1.3% -1.3 pp

Shares are of this district's reported F-33 teacher-salary program totals (Z35–Z38), compared with the median share across 653 in-state peers with a positive program sum. NCES LEAID 3904875 · FY2023.

This pay stretches further than the headline figure suggests

Nominal district estimate
$95,905.325

The FY2023 salary estimate shown in the hero.

Ohio price level
91.9 / 100

BEA all-items regional price parity; 100 is the U.S. average.

National-price equivalent
$104,355

+9% versus the nominal figure.

Prices in Ohio run below the national average, so this salary has roughly the buying power of the national-price equivalent above. A district in a costlier state can advertise a larger nominal salary and still leave a teacher with less.

Regional price parity: U.S. Bureau of Economic Analysis, 2023 all-items RPP by state. The adjustment applies a statewide index to a district figure, so it captures how Ohio compares nationally, not how this district compares with others in its own state. Compare every state on this basis.

What the Numbers Say About Huber Heights City

Huber Heights City is a small-to-mid-sized school district in Ohio, serving 5,903 students at an estimated per-pupil spending of $15,496. Estimated average teacher salary, derived from reported teacher salary expenditure (F-33 items Z35-Z38) divided by teacher FTE, is $95,905, placing the district in the moderately funded tier of NCES F-33 respondents. NCES LEAID 3904875 references the FY2023 Common Core of Data Local Education Agency Finance Survey.

Relative to the Ohio statewide average of $80,477, teacher pay in Huber Heights City runs meaningfully above the state benchmark, a 19.2% gap, and above the national instructional-salary estimate of $70,245 (36.5% differential). Among enrolling districts in Ohio, it pays more than 86% of them. Ohio itself ranks #13 of 49 nationally on average teacher compensation, which shapes the funding ceiling districts operate under.

On the budget side, Huber Heights City reports $91.5M in total expenditure against $94.9M in revenue, with instructional salaries accounting for 37% of spending, a compensation-to-budget ratio that signals how much of each tax dollar reaches classroom educators. Regular-program teacher salary outlay is $22.1M, special-education teacher pay is $7.8M.

Instructional Salary by Program

$22.1M
Regular Program
$7.8M
Special Education

The teacher salaries behind this page's average are the ones NCES reports for 2 programs in Huber Heights City: the regular program and special education. It reports no separate figure for vocational programs and other programs. Together they are 88% of everything the district spends on instructional salaries; the other 12% pays instructional aides, paraprofessionals, substitutes and other instructional staff who are not counted as teachers here.
